48V Lithium Battery: The Powerhouse

When it comes to energy storage solutions, the 48V lithium battery is a true powerhouse. These batteries are known for their high efficiency, which means they can deliver more power for longer periods of time compared to lead-acid batteries. With over 5,000+ cycles, 48V lithium batteries are built to last, making them ideal for applications where performance and longevity are key.

Lightweight and Reliable

One of the standout features of 48V lithium batteries is their lightweight design. Compared to lead-acid batteries, which can be bulky and heavy, lithium batteries are much more compact and easy to handle. This makes them a popular choice for golf carts and solar systems, where weight and size can be significant factors.

Built-in BMS Safety

Another key advantage of 48V lithium batteries is their built-in Battery Management System (BMS), which helps to monitor and regulate the battery's performance. The BMS ensures that the battery operates within safe parameters, protecting it from overcharging, overheating, and other potential risks. This added layer of safety gives users peace of mind knowing that their battery is well-protected.

Lead-Acid Battery: The Traditional Choice

Lead-acid batteries have been around for decades and are a tried-and-true option for energy storage. While they may not offer the same level of performance or lifespan as lithium batteries, lead-acid batteries are still a reliable choice for many applications.

Cost-Effective Option

One of the main advantages of lead-acid batteries is their affordability. Compared to lithium batteries, lead-acid batteries are typically more budget-friendly, making them a popular choice for consumers looking to save money upfront. However, it's important to consider the long-term costs and benefits when comparing the two types of batteries.
